LINDSAY, Page J. 72, of Arlington, passed away on February 3, 2013 surrounded by family at home. Beloved wife of Donald Lindsay for almost 50 years. Devoted mother of Robin Lindsay and her husband William Papin of Palm Bay, FL, Brooke Lindsay and her husband Robert Burchell of Arlington, VA, Jennifer Burger and her husband John Burger of Ithaca, NY, and Mark Lindsay and his wife Jennifer Klahn of Salem, MA. Dear grandmother of Sophie Burchell, Ethan Burchell, Julia Papin, and Lily Papin. She is also survived by her brother Gregory Johnson and his wife Bonnie Johnson of Bethlehem, CT. A Funeral Service will be held at St. John's Episcopal Church, 74 Pleasant St., Arlington, MA on Saturday morning at 11:00 a.m. In lieu of flowers, donations may be made in Page's name to Heifer International, P.O. Box 8058, Little Rock, AR 72203. www.devitofuneralhomes.com
